Well, Murio, Brawl's netcode at the moment forced a few frames of input lag on the players no matter how good their connection is. I can't really say if we have any plans to improve the online experience, of it it is at all possible (I'm not an ASM coder), but it's a problem inherent in Brawl's coding. There are often poeple availiable for online play in the chat, but for optimal experience, I'd suggest checking your regional boards. There are a lot of smashers like you who want smashing partners.
